Warning on the Inn at the Crossroads noticeboard[ | ]

Warning
Tw3 notice board note 1
Note pinned to a notice board
Description
Category
Common item
Source
Notice board by the Inn at the Crossroads
Notice board in Mulbrydale

Contents[ | ]

Good folk,
If you see any wonders hanging in the woods, such as treats fit for Yuletide dangling off branches – gingerbakings, honeyed apples, fritters or pies – then no matter how fierce your belly growls, turn back. Whoever partakes of those treats is never seen among the living again.

Warning on notice board in Oxenfurt[ | ]

Warning
Tw3 notice board note 2
Note pinned to a notice board
Description
Category
Common item
Expansion
Hearts of Stone
Source
Notice board in Oxenfurt

Contents[ | ]

The individual who vandalized the city walls with the inscription "King Raddy will die like his daddy" must report to the nearest military outpost at once. I remind all Oxenfurt students that university privileges, the freedom of expression included, have been revoked and further such outbursts will not be tolerated.
Addendum
The half-literate moron who wrote "aep arse" (spelled with a double "s" and an accent mark) on another wall is also to report to the nearest military outpost at once. Failure to do so will result in an investigation being launched and the perpetrator being prosecuted to the fullest extent of the law.
–Commander Donimir Vierny
